What is minimum expenses incurred by the composition and evaluation of the Request for EOI and Prequalification in Vietnam?
Pursuant to Article 9 of Decree 63/2014/ND-CP stipulating expenses incurred during the selection of contractors as follows:
1. Based on the size and nature of the contracts, investors decide the selling price of one set of bidding documents and request for proposals (taxes included) for the domestic bidding, including the maximum price of VND 2,000,000 for the bid envelope and VND 1,000,000 for the Request for Proposals; as for the international bidding, such selling prices shall adhere to the international bidding practices.
2. Expenses incurred by the composition and evaluation of the Request for EOI and Prequalification:
a) Expenses incurred by the composition of the Request for EOI and Prequalification account for 0.05% of the bid price but are identified at the minimum price of VND 1,000,000 and the maximum price of VND 30,000,000;
b) Expenses incurred by the evaluation of the Request for EOI and Prequalification account for 0.03% of the bid price but are identified at the minimum price of VND 1,000,000 and the maximum price of VND 30,000,000;
3. Expenditure on compilation and evaluation of the Invitation for Bids and Request for Proposals:
a) Expenses incurred by the composition of the Invitation for Bids and Request for Proposals account for 0.1% of the bid price but are identified at the minimum price of VND 1,000,000 and the maximum price of VND 50,000,000;
b) Expenses incurred by the evaluation of the Invitation for Bids and Request for Proposals account for 0.05% of the bid price but are identified at the minimum price of VND 1,000,000 and the maximum price of VND 50,000,000;
4. Expenses incurred by the evaluation of the EOI Response, Prequalification, Bid Envelope and Proposals:
a) Expenses incurred by the evaluation of the EOI Response and Prequalification account for 0.05% of the bid price but are identified at the minimum price of VND 1,000,000 and the maximum price of VND 30,000,000;
b) Expenses incurred by the evaluation of Bid Envelopes and Proposals account for 0.1% of the bid price but are identified at the minimum price of VND 1,000,000 and the maximum price of VND 50,000,000.
5. Expenses incurred by the evaluation of the result of the selection of contractors, even when there are none of selected contractors, account for 0.05% of the bid price but are identified at the minimum price of VND 1,000,000 and the maximum price of VND 50,000,000.
6. In respect of the contracts that elaborate the same contents in the same project and purchase estimate as well as the contracts that require redoing the selection of contractors, expenses incurred by the composition and evaluation of the Request for EOI and Prequalification; Invitation for Bids and Request for Proposals account for maximum 50% of the expense regulated in Clause 2 and Clause 3 of this Article. In case of the contracts that require another selection of contractors, expenses on the selection of contracts for the project and purchase estimates must be accounted for and supplemented to meet the actual requirements mentioned in the contracts.
7. Expenses prescribed in Clause 2, 3, 4, 5 and 6 of this Article shall be applicable to investors and procuring entities who are directly involved in the bidding. In case bidder’s consultants are hired to carry out the contents specified in Clause 2, 3, 4, 5 and 6 of this Article, expenses are defined on the basis of the content, scope of work, execution period, competence and experience of consultants and other elements.
8. Expenses paid to a council in charge of considering the contractor's recommendations on the selection of contractors (hereinafter referred to as Advisory Council) account for 0.02% of the quoted bid of the bidders who have made recommendations but are identified at the minimum price of VND 1,000,000 and the maximum price of VND 50,000,000.
9. Expenses incurred by the dissemination of bidding information and participation in the national bidding network and the use of receipts during the selection of contractors shall follow the instructions from the Ministry of Planning and Investment and the Ministry of Finance.
Thus, according to current regulations in Vietnam, the cost of the bidding dossier is 0.05% of the bid package price, but it is necessary to ensure the minimum price is 1 million VND.
Is there a fee for issuance of EOI requests in Vietnam?
According to Clause 1, Article 13 of the Law on Bidding 2013 regulations on expenses associated with bidding:
1. Expenses associated with the process of selection of bidder include:
a) Expenses associated with preparation of EOI responses, Applications, Bids, Proposals and participation in bidding shall be borne by bidders;
b) Expenses associated with process of bidder selection shall be included in total investment or estimated budget of procurement;
c) EOI requests, Prequalification Documents shall be issued to bidders free of charge;
d) Bidding Documents, Requests for Proposals shall be sold or issued free of charge to bidders.
According to this Article, EOI requests will be issued to bidders free of charge in Vietnam.
